Magnetic technology could change how computer memory works

Washington-ALsharqiya May 8: Researchers at Cornell University in the United States have developed a technique to change the direction of electron spin in magnetic materials, which may help in the production and development of more energy-efficient magnetic memory devices, and may change the mechanism of computer memories. The researchers published their study in the scientific journal Nature Electronics, in which they referred to the use of spin-borne currents on electrons that exist when electrons spin in one direction. The researchers found that when the spin currents interact with a thin magnetic layer, its angular momentum transfers and generates enough torque to switch the magnetization 180 degrees.
